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Peer inclusion criteria: 1. Cancer was confirmed by pathological diagnosis; 2. Cancer survivors who have returned to work or have returned to work experience, or members of cancer friendship Association; 3. Age >=18 years old; 4. Informed consent and voluntary participation in the study; 5. High school or above; 6. Good cognitive function, can use WeChat and other intelligent software. Cancer survivor inclusion criteria: 1. Cancer was confirmed by pathological diagnosis; 2. Survivors who are receiving treatment in a hospital without disease progression or in the rehabilitation period; 3. Having a job before treatment; 4. Age >=18 years old, and < 60 years old; 5. Informed consent and voluntary participation in the study; 6. Good cognitive function, can use wechat and other intelligent software.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Peer exclusion criteria: 1. History of mental disorder or mental illness; 2. Serious complications of other systems; 3. Advanced cancer (distant metastasis). Exclusion criteria for cancer survivors were the same as peer exclusion criteria.
